180(n-2) = SUM
o
n = # of sides of the polygon
o
SUM = sum of all the interior angles of the polygon
The sum of all exterior angles of a polygon is 360°
Regular polygons have sides and angles that are all congruent

Both pairs of opposite sides are congruent
Both pairs of opposite sides are parallel
Both pairs of opposite angles are congruent
All adjacent angles are supplementary
Diagonals bisect each other
A Quadrilateral is a Parallelogram if…


Any of the above are true
One pair of opposite sides are both congruent and parallel
Rhombuses
Rectangles


Have all the properties of parallelograms,
plus…
o
All sides are congruent
o
Diagonals are perpendicular
o
Diagonals are angle bisectors
Have all the properties of parallelograms,
plus…
o
All angles are congruent (90°)
o
Diagonals are congruent
Squares

Have all the properties of parallelograms, rhombuses and rectangles
o
A square IS a parallelogram, rhombus and rectangle

Are NOT parallelograms
Exactly one pair of opposites sides is parallel
The parallel sides are called bases
The non-parallel sides are called legs
MIDSEGMENT: The midsegment of a trapezoid is
a segment that connects the midpoints of the legs
Isosceles Trapezoids

Have all the properties of trapezoids, plus…
o
Base angle pairs are congruent
o
Legs are congruent (but bases are
NEVER congruent in a trapezoid)
o
Diagonals are congruent
Kites





Are NOT parallelograms
Opposite sides are NOT congruent
Two pairs of adjacent sides ARE congruent
Diagonals are perpendicular
Exactly one pair of opposite angles are congruent
